Independencia Square is the center of Quito City. Around this square square, there are buildings full of artistic features of the late Italian Renaissance. Most of these buildings are two storeys with stone gates intricately carved. The Catholic Church at the southern end of the square, built in 1550 and completed in the 18th century, has a green tile dome and a gray and white column supporting the porch. It is a mixture of Arabic, Persian and Moorish architectural styles. The name of the founder of Quito City is inlaid with gold leaves on the outer wall, and there is the tomb of General Sucre in the courtyard. Opposite the church is the main palace, and the northwest corner of the square is the majestic government palace.
